The MAXX-D G8X is the heavy-duty big brother to the G6X. While they share the same gravity-tilt DNA, the G8X is engineered for the contractor or operator stepping up to 17,500 lb. GVWR
It is designed to handle the increased weight of mid-sized excavators and heavy-spec skid steers that would push a standard 14K trailer to its legal and structural limits.
CORE FEATURES OF THE MAXX-D G8X Gravity-Tilt with Hydraulic Cushion Cylinder The G8X uses a heavy-duty hydraulic dampening cylinder to control the deck’s movement.
8" x 3" x 1/4" Heavy-Duty Tube Steel Frame While the G6X uses a 6" tube, the G8X jumps to a massive 8" boxed tube frame.
8,000 lb. Dexter® Torsion Axles (Standard) The G8X comes standard with 8K axles
Split-Deck Design (Stationary Front + Tilting Rear) Most G8X models are configured with a 4' to 8' stationary front deck and a 16' tilting rear section.
Knife-Edge Tapered Tail The rear of the tilt deck features a reinforced, low-profile steel "knife edge."
Standard 12,000 lb. Drop-Leg Jack To handle the increased tongue weight of 16K+ loads, the G8X steps up to a heavy-duty 12K jack.
THE G8X QUICK SPECS - GVWR: 17,500 lbs
G8X vs. G6X: WHY STEP UP? 1. Axle Strength: The move to 8K axles and 17.5" tires virtually eliminates "flat-tire anxiety" on the highway. 2. Frame Bulk: The 8" tube frame is significantly more resistant to the "twisting" forces applied by heavy, off-center equipment. 3. Legal Payload: With the 16K or 17.5K GVWR, you can legally haul the newest generation of heavy-spec compact track loaders (CTLs) that often exceed the 10,000 lb. machine weight.
